(NewsNation) — The father of Kaylee Goncalves, one of four University of Idaho students murdered by Bryan Kohberger in 2022, says he has heard of the killer's struggles in Idaho's supermax prison.

In addition to Kaylee Goncalves, Madison Mogen, Ethan Chapain and Xana Kernodle were also murdered.

Steve Goncavles and his daughter, Alivea, joined "Banfield" on Tuesday to discuss the latest updates surrounding the murders.

"I have heard that he isn't doing so well in that prison system that he's in, the block that he's at. He's very adamant that he has rights in there that need to be respected," Steve Kohberger said.

"You don't do the crime if you can't do the time. And he's going to be doing the time. And I've been hearing a lot about how the amount of noise that he's making in there isn't doing him any favors."

Lifetime's reported plans for a movie about the murders have frustrated some members of the family, including Kaylee's sister, Alivea.

Actor Miles Merry has been cast as Kohberger in the "Ripped From the Headlines" movie, according to Deadline.

"It's really angering. Honestly, from my side, my sisters aren't a headline; they're not a Lifetime movie, and I get incredibly frustrated at the scripted aspect of it," Alivea told NewsNation.

The Goncalves family was not consulted or given advance notice before the public announcement about the movie.

"It's shocking to know that somebody feels that confident that they can just tell your story about your child and, you know, Maddie [Mogen], her best friend, the same people that, you know, you interacted with every day...," Steve Goncalves said.

"It doesn't seem real. It seems like somebody's just reaching into your house and stealing your life and putting it on the screen."
